Homemade Queso Cheese Dip Recipe!

Do you order the queso cheese dip when you go out for Mexican?  We do!  Almost every time.  That and guacamole are our favorite appetizers to get and munch on while we're waiting for our meals.

I've wondered for years how to make it.  Mainly because sometimes I just want the queso dip and not a whole meal.  That or I just don't want to go out 🙂

Depending on where you are in the country sometimes the correct cheeses are difficult to find.  But when you CAN find them this dip it's very good!  When you can't find the real cheeses Velveeta has a white queso they make specifically for this purpose.  Some folks have issue with Velveeta.  Some don't.  I personally don't, but that's your choice 🙂

Also depending on the cheese brand you're able to find sometimes you'll need to add more cream or even some milk to get it to the right consistency.  They all vary a little.  That's weird to me but it's been my experience thus far...so fyi on that one.

Variations for Queso Cheese Dip

You can also add different seasonings and spices if you like.  A dash of chili seasoning, diced up Serrano peppers or even a packet of taco seasoning.  I've tried those and homemade Pico De Galla.  It may sound sorta gross but mixing this queso cheese dip recipe with equal parts pico de galla and guacamole...well, it's amazing!

Ingredients:

Queso Cheese Dip

  • 1 pint Heavy Cream
  • 3 1/2 to 5 ounces Goat Cheese
  • 12 to 14 ounces Queso Fresco Cheese

Instructions:

  1. Spray, oil or butter your slow cooker insert.
  2. Dice cheeses and toss in the crockpot.
  3. Add 2/3's the cream and stir.
  4. Cover and cook on low for 1 1/2 to 2 hours before removing the lid.
  5. Open up the crockpot and stir the cheeses well.  Add more cream and/or milk as needed to get to the right consistency.
  6. Cover and cook until you're able to stir all the lumps away and your dip is smooth and creamy.
  7. Turn onto "warm" setting until you're ready to serve.
